Kellee Booth, a senior on the Arizona State golf team, is the winner of the Honda Award as the top collegiate women’s golfer. Booth, a former Santa Margarita High standout, finished fourth in the NCAA tournament, helping the Sun Devils to their second consecutive team title and third in her four years at the school.
